TL;DR Summary

The Knicks routed the Hawks 140-89 in Game 6, but a second-quarter scuffle between Mitchell Robinson and Dyson Daniels triggered two ejections. Robinson had just 8:45 on the floor with six points before the incident, returned from an earlier hobble, and helped fuel a blowout that grew to a 50-point lead. Knicks coach Mike Brown and staff helped defuse the situation; a suspension for Robinson appears unlikely given Jokic-era precedents.
